Best Places to Visit in Bangkok
1️⃣ The Grand Palace
One of Bangkok’s most iconic attractions, the Grand Palace showcases stunning Thai architecture and historical importance. It is a must-visit for first-time travelers.
2️⃣ Wat Arun (Temple of Dawn)
Located along the Chao Phraya River, Wat Arun is famous for its unique design and beautiful sunset views.
3️⃣ Floating Markets
Bangkok’s floating markets offer a unique shopping experience where vendors sell food and goods from boats.
4️⃣ Chatuchak Weekend Market
Perfect for shopping lovers. You can find clothes, souvenirs, handicrafts, and local snacks.
Bangkok Trip Cost from India (2026 Estimate)
Here is a rough breakdown for a 3-day Bangkok stay:
| Expense | Approx Cost (Per Person) |
|---|---|
| Flights (Return) | ₹18,000 – ₹28,000 |
| Hotel (3 nights) | ₹6,000 – ₹12,000 |
| Food | ₹3,000 – ₹5,000 |
| Local Transport | ₹2,000 – ₹4,000 |
| Attractions | ₹3,000 – ₹5,000 |
Total Estimated Budget: ₹35,000 – ₹55,000 per person.

3 Days Bangkok Itinerary
Day 1: Cultural Exploration
Grand Palace
Wat Pho
Wat Arun
Evening river cruise
Day 2: Markets & Shopping
Floating market tour
MBK or Siam Paragon
Chinatown food walk
Day 3: Leisure & Modern Bangkok
Safari World or city parks
Rooftop dining
Night market visit

Best Time to Visit Bangkok
The ideal time to visit Bangkok is between November and February when the weather is pleasant and suitable for sightseeing.

Where to Stay in Bangkok
Bangkok offers accommodation options for every budget:
Sukhumvit – Best for nightlife and restaurants
Siam – Ideal for shopping
Riverside – Luxury stay with scenic views
Families usually prefer centrally located hotels for easy access to transport.
Is Bangkok Safe for Indian Tourists?
Bangkok is generally safe for tourists. However:
Avoid isolated areas at night
Use licensed taxis
Keep important documents secure
Thailand’s tourism infrastructure is well developed, making it beginner-friendly for international travelers.

Final Travel Tips for Bangkok 2026
Book flights early
Carry some Thai Baht
Use BTS Skytrain for traffic-free travel
Respect temple dress codes
Keep digital copies of documents
